When it comes to caring for your US flag, knowing the fabric type is crucial. Different fabrics have distinct care requirements. For instance, nylon flags are durable and easy to maintain, requiring minimal effort such as occasional shaking to keep them flying high. Polyester flags, another common option, offer vibrant colors and are resistant to fading, but should be gently washed to preserve their quality. Cotton flags, though beautiful in design, demand more attention with regular cleaning and protection from harsh weather conditions.

Proper Storage Techniques to Prolong Lifespan

Proper storage is an essential aspect of extending the lifespan of your US flags, especially if they are meant for long-term display. When not in use, ensure your flag is st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Avoid stacking or folding the flag roughly; instead, roll it gently to prevent damage and creases. A popular method among enthusiasts is to use a flag storage tube, which provides a protective enclosure, keeping out dust and moisture.

Strategies for Removing Stains and Discoloration

Stains and discolouration on flags can be an unsightly issue, but with a few simple strategies, you can keep your US flag near me or any open-air display looking vibrant. Regular cleaning is key; use a soft brush to gently remove any dust or debris, especially before washing. For stubborn stains, soak the flag in a mixture of mild detergent and warm water for 30 minutes, then hand wash it with care. Avoid using harsh chemicals or machines as they can damage the fabric. Rinse thoroughly after cleaning and allow it to air dry completely to prevent any further discolouration from occurring.
Consider the type of fabric when choosing a cleaning method; cotton and polyester flags may require different approaches than those made from nylon or other synthetic materials.
